Day 43 - Good Choices - The Internet, Games, Drugs and Alcohol

The Internet and Games
• alert children to the benefits and dangers
• put filters on home computers
• keep computers in family room
• enforce time limits for being online and playing games Drugs and alcohol
• have conversations throughout their upbringing
• equip them with the facts to inform and protect them

Question:
What should you do to restrict your child’s time online, and playing games, and how can you keep them safe? How can you try to give your children a healthy attitude toward drugs and alcohol?

Home is a place for fun!

  • As parents we may need to lighten up
  • Teenagers want to be where the fun is
  • Can they bring friends home? Consider creating some teenager-friendly space in your house
  • Have relaxed family meal times
  • Laugh together
  • The value of family vacations

What changes would you like to make to your family’s home life, to make sure you can have fun together?
